This pro-level XC flyer pairs new FlexPoint Pro rear suspension with a superlight full composite frame and race-ready geometry. It’s the ultimate weapon for technical cross-country terrain.

Highlights

Engineered with a full composite frame, this 29er has 100mm of rear suspension travel. The linkage-driven, single-pivot FlexPoint Pro rear suspension makes room for shorter chainstays to improve climbing capabilities and overall agility. Other updates include new 29er-specific XC race geometry with a longer reach and a slacker headtube angle plus a new design for internal cable routing.

Techs & Features

Advanced Composite Technology

Giant’s High Performance Grade raw carbon material is used to produce this custom frame material in our own composite factory with a high stiffness-to-weight ratio. The front triangle of these framesets is assembled and molded as one continuous piece in a proprietary manufacturing process called Modified Monocoque Construction.

Advanced Forged Composite Technology

A state-of-the-art high-pressure molding process is used to produce complex-shaped carbon fiber components that are lighter, stiffer and stronger than similar components made from aluminum. This technology is used in critical performance parts such as Maestro Suspension rocker links.

FlexPoint Pro Suspension Technology

Developed as a superlight rear suspension setup for XC bikes that demand efficiency, control and responsive handling, FlexPoint Pro is a linkage-driven, single-pivot system that delivers 100mm of rear-wheel travel. It’s engineered with a full-composite swingarm that significantly reduces overall frame weight.

OverDrive

Giant’s original oversized fork steerer tube technology. Designed to provide precise front-end steering performance, the system’s oversized headset bearings (1 1/4” lower and 1 1/8” upper for road, 1 1/2” lower and 1 1/8” upper for mountain) and tapered steerer tube work in conjunction to provide optimal steering stiffness.

PowerCore

A massively oversized bottom-bracket/chainstay area features a fully integrated, 86-millimeter wide bottom-bracket design (92-millimeter wide for off-road bikes). Asymmetric chainstays provide additional stiffness on the driveside and stability on the non-driveside.
